The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
  • n. A very large carnivorous dinosaur of the Upper Cretaceous Period of North America, characterized by small forelimbs and a large head.
  •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License
  • n. Any large bipedal carnivorous dinosaur, of the family Tyrannosauridae, that lived in North America during the Cretaceous period.
  • WordNet 3.0 Copyright 2006 by Princeton University. All rights reserved.
  • n. large carnivorous bipedal dinosaur having enormous teeth with knifelike serrations; may have been a scavenger rather than an active predator; later Cretaceous period in North America
